Colorado Code § 30-8-104

Removal - when

No county seat shall be removed until the expiration of
thirty days after the canvass of the votes by the county canvassers upon the question of location
or removal, nor until the board of county commissioners of such county has made and entered of
record on its journal an order directing such removal. The board shall make such order within
thirty days after the county canvass is completed, unless enjoined or restrained from so doing by
an order of the district court of said county or by the supreme court.
